As climate change exacerbates the frequency and intensity of natural disasters, Southeast Asia is experiencing an urgent need for effective disaster management solutions. In particular, Indonesia faces frequent flooding, which has prompted local governments to adopt advanced technologies like drones for emergency response. Utilizing aerial technology not only speeds up rescue efforts but also provides critical data for assessing damage and strategizing recovery efforts.
The integration of drone technology into emergency operations has become a game-changer in Indonesia. Drones equipped with cameras and sensors can quickly survey affected areas from above, offering real-time insights that ground teams require for effective decision-making. This capability is particularly valuable in densely populated urban settings like Jakarta and Surabaya, where ground access can be challenging during disasters.

Emergency response relies heavily on coordination between various agencies. Drones serve as a communication bridge, ensuring all parties have access to the same information. This collaboration becomes vital during large-scale incidents where numerous governmental and non-governmental organizations are involved. For instance, during recent flooding events, drones have allowed seamless information sharing between local authorities and rescue teams.
Despite the promising benefits, there are hurdles to overcome in integrating drones into Southeast Asian disaster management frameworks. Regulatory issues, lack of trained personnel, and limited public awareness can impede their effective use. However, these challenges also present opportunities for development in the region's UAV industry. Investing in drone training programs and public-private partnerships can enhance operational readiness.
Emphasizing local talent and innovation is crucial for the successful implementation of drone technology. Countries like Indonesia have shown potential in developing homegrown solutions tailored to local needs. This not only fosters economic growth but also builds resilience within communities. For instance, integrating community feedback into drone operations can yield more effective emergency strategies.
The role of drones in disaster management is set to expand significantly as technology continues to evolve. Their ability to provide real-time data and facilitate efficient rescue operations makes them indispensable in emergency response frameworks throughout Southeast Asia. As governments and organizations increasingly recognize their potential, the future of drone technology in regions vulnerable to natural disasters like Indonesia looks promising.
